Transaction 12804cd9589214d90e89335ed27ecf6b43ea0851c37b58b2ad0dce29bc4edd32
1 Input
1 Output
-
12804cd9589214d90e89335ed27ecf6b43ea0851c37b58b2ad0dce29bc4edd32:0
- value
- 4059028
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 508f54d3d5ee1eb7d0a3b63b3f51f31803aeb64b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18LxmBf5UQhPdnqeS8jkPE4gci5BK8f8hD